Ver Mensaje Individual
  #3 (permalink)  
Antiguo 06/07/2007, 16:43
NeoKaisser
 
Fecha de Ingreso: julio-2003
Mensajes: 240
Antigüedad: 21 años, 8 meses
Puntos: 1
Re: Redimensionar arrays dinámicamente.

Hola tunait, gracias por la respuesta, he leído eso en muchas webs, pero.... no, no me funciona.

Este es el código del archivo XSL. Falta el XML, pero en este caso no es relevante.

Código PHP:
<?xml version="1.0" encoding="iso-8859-1"?><!-- DWXMLSource="date_ultimo.xml" -->
<x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form">

<xsl:template match="/">
<html>

 <Body>

  <h1>Tipos de posibles representaciones para el tipo "date".</h1>

    <Script language="JavaScript">
        // Variables    
                      XML = new Array();
            XML[0] = new Array();
            XML[1] = new Array();
            XML[2] = new Array();
                
            Pos = 0;

// Función para añadir las elecciones de representación del usuario.

function AñadirEleccion(Tabla, Campo, CodRep, NombreRep){
    
//Añado la información de la representacion en XML al array
    XML[Pos][0]=Tabla;
    XML[Pos][1]=Campo;
    XML[Pos][2]=CodRep;          
    XML[Pos][3]=NombreRep; 
        
                    
Pos = Pos + 1;
        
    }


</Script>


// Más código no relevante...bla, bla,.....

 </Body>
 </html>

 </xsl:template>
</xsl:stylesheet>
Cuando Pos vale 3 ó 4 el script falla. No redimensiona automaticamente, no lo hace ¿Por qué?

Un saludo y gracias.